DescriptionN-(4-(aminomethyl)-2,6-dimethylphenyl)-5 is a potent, selective antagonist of the sphingosine-1-phosphate receptor 4 (S1P4). CYM50358 inhibits S1P4 with an IC50 of 25 nM.(In Vitro):N-(4-(aminomethyl)-2,6-dimethylphenyl)-5 shows less potent inhibition of S1PR1(IC50=6.4μM).N-(4-(aminomethyl)-2,6-dimethylphenyl)-5(10μM)has no effect on the collagen-induced HSP27 phosphorylation,markedly reverses the suppressive effect of S1P on the collagen-induced phospphorylation of HSP27.
